矢量数据库的未来发展趋势:新技术与应用展望

简介: 【4月更文挑战第30天】随着AI和机器学习的发展,矢量数据库在处理非结构化数据方面的重要性日益增强。预测到2028年,全球矢量数据库市场将从2023年的15亿美元增长至43亿美元。未来趋势包括:并行计算与分布式架构提升处理能力,硬件加速技术(如TPU和昇腾芯片)提高性能,自适应索引机制优化查询效率。应用领域将拓展至NLP、图像视频分析和推荐系统,为各行业带来更多创新和价值。

2000元阿里云代金券免费领取,2核4G云服务器仅664元/3年,新老用户都有优惠,立即抢购>>>


阿里云采购季(云主机223元/3年)活动入口:请点击进入>>>,


阿里云学生服务器(9.5元/月)购买入口:请点击进入>>>,

一、引言

随着大数据、人工智能和机器学习等技术的飞速发展,矢量数据库作为处理高维空间数据的重要工具,其重要性日益凸显。矢量数据库以其高效存储、检索和处理非结构化数据的能力,正在引领数据领域的新一轮变革。本文将探讨矢量数据库的未来发展趋势,以及新技术和应用对其发展的推动作用。

二、矢量数据库的未来发展趋势

  1. 持续增长的市场需求

根据市场研究报告,全球矢量数据库市场有望实现显著增长。到2028年,预计市场规模将从2023年的15亿美元增长到43亿美元,复合年增长率高达23.3%。这种强劲的增长主要归因于人工智能和机器学习应用背景下对矢量数据库的需求不断上升。随着这些技术的普及,对于高效处理非结构化数据的需求也在不断增加,矢量数据库将在其中发挥越来越重要的作用。

  1. 技术创新推动发展

(1)并行计算与分布式架构:随着数据量的不断增长,单台服务器的处理能力可能无法满足需求。因此,矢量数据库将越来越多地采用并行计算和分布式架构,将数据分散到多个节点上进行存储和查询,以提高系统的吞吐量和响应时间。

(2)硬件加速技术:随着异构处理器的高速发展,如谷歌的张量处理器(TPU)和华为的昇腾系列芯片等,硬件加速技术将为矢量数据库的性能提升提供新的可能。这些处理器可以针对特定的计算任务进行加速,如线性代数计算、深度学习等,从而提高矢量数据库在处理复杂查询和机器学习任务时的性能。

(3)自适应索引机制:传统的索引机制可能无法满足实时数据分析的需求。因此,矢量数据库将越来越多地采用自适应索引机制,根据数据的分布情况和查询需求自动选择和优化索引策略,以提高查询效率和准确性。

  1. 应用领域的拓展

(1)自然语言处理(NLP):矢量数据库可以将文本数据转换为高维向量表示,并基于向量相似性进行文本匹配和语义分析。因此,在NLP领域,矢量数据库将发挥越来越重要的作用,如文本分类、情感分析、信息抽取等任务。

(2)图像和视频分析:矢量数据库可以高效地存储和检索图像和视频数据,并基于特征向量进行相似度计算和分类。因此,在图像和视频分析领域,矢量数据库将具有广泛的应用前景,如人脸识别、目标检测、行为分析等任务。

(3)推荐系统:在推荐系统中,矢量数据库可以基于用户的历史行为和偏好信息构建用户画像,并与其他物品或内容进行相似度计算和匹配。因此,矢量数据库将成为推荐系统中的重要组成部分,提高推荐的准确性和个性化程度。

三、结论

矢量数据库作为处理高维空间数据的重要工具,其未来发展前景广阔。随着市场需求的不断增长、技术创新的推动以及应用领域的拓展,矢量数据库将在数据领域发挥越来越重要的作用。我们期待着矢量数据库在未来能够带来更多的创新和突破,为人类社会带来更多的便利和价值。

相关文章
|
4天前
|
缓存 关系型数据库 Java
不要将数据库中的“分库分表”理论盲目应用到 Elasticsearch
不要将数据库中的“分库分表”理论盲目应用到 Elasticsearch
16 0
|
4天前
|
存储 人工智能 NoSQL
现代数据库技术演进与应用前景分析
本文探讨了现代数据库技术的演进历程及其在各领域的应用前景。首先介绍了传统数据库的局限性,随后分析了NoSQL、NewSQL以及分布式数据库等新兴技术的特点和优势。接着探讨了人工智能、物联网、大数据等领域对数据库技术提出的新要求,并展望了未来数据库技术的发展趋势与应用前景。
|
4天前
|
存储 NoSQL 搜索推荐
探索新一代数据库技术:基于图数据库的应用与优势
传统关系型数据库在处理复杂的关系数据时存在着诸多限制,而基于图数据库的新一代数据库技术则提供了更为灵活和高效的解决方案。本文将深入探讨图数据库的核心概念、应用场景以及与传统数据库相比的优势,带领读者一窥未来数据库技术的发展趋势。
|
4天前
|
存储 运维 Kubernetes
多态关联在数据库设计中的应用和解决方案
多态关联在数据库设计中的应用和解决方案
18 0
|
4天前
|
运维 Prometheus 监控
矢量数据库系统监控与运维:确保稳定运行的关键要素
【4月更文挑战第30天】本文探讨了确保矢量数据库系统稳定运行的监控与运维关键要素。监控方面,关注响应时间、吞吐量、资源利用率和错误率等指标,使用Prometheus等工具实时收集分析,并有效管理日志。运维上,强调备份恢复、性能调优、安全管理和自动化运维。关键成功因素包括建立全面监控体系、科学的运维策略、提升运维人员技能和团队协作。通过这些措施,可保障矢量数据库系统的稳定运行,支持业务发展。
|
4天前
|
存储 大数据 测试技术
矢量数据库的性能测试与评估方法
【4月更文挑战第30天】本文探讨了矢量数据库的性能测试与评估方法,强调其在大数据和AI时代的重要性。文中介绍了负载测试、压力测试、容量测试、功能测试和稳定性测试五大评估方法,以及实施步骤,包括确定测试目标、设计用例、准备环境、执行测试和分析结果。这些方法有助于确保数据库的稳定性和高效性,推动技术发展。
|
4天前
|
存储 算法 数据库
矢量数据库在图像识别与检索中的应用实践
【4月更文挑战第30天】本文探讨了矢量数据库在图像识别与检索中的应用,通过特征提取(如SIFT、SURF)、编码和相似度度量实现快速识别。在图像检索流程中,经过预处理、特征提取和编码后,矢量数据库用于查询相似特征,排序后展示给用户。实际案例显示,矢量数据库能提升电商平台的商品图像搜索效率和用户体验。随着技术发展,这一领域应用前景广阔。
|
4天前
|
存储 大数据 数据处理
矢量数据库与大数据平台的集成:实现高效数据处理
【4月更文挑战第30天】本文探讨了矢量数据库与大数据平台的集成,以实现高效数据处理。集成通过API、中间件或容器化方式,结合两者优势,提升处理效率,简化流程,并增强数据安全。关键技术支持包括分布式计算、数据压缩编码、索引优化和流处理,以优化性能和实时性。随着技术发展,这种集成将在数据处理领域发挥更大作用。
|
4天前
|
存储 数据挖掘 数据库
矢量数据库在实时数据分析中的作用与挑战
【4月更文挑战第30天】本文探讨了矢量数据库在实时数据分析中的关键作用,包括高效存储与检索高维数据、支持复杂空间查询及实时更新同步。面对数据规模增长、安全性与隐私保护以及实时性与准确性挑战,文章提出分布式架构、数据加密、优化传输机制等解决方案。随着技术发展,矢量数据库在实时数据分析领域将持续发挥重要作用。
|
2天前
|
关系型数据库 MySQL API
实时计算 Flink版产品使用合集之可以通过mysql-cdc动态监听MySQL数据库的数据变动吗
实时计算Flink版作为一种强大的流处理和批处理统一的计算框架,广泛应用于各种需要实时数据处理和分析的场景。实时计算Flink版通常结合SQL接口、DataStream API、以及与上下游数据源和存储系统的丰富连接器,提供了一套全面的解决方案,以应对各种实时计算需求。其低延迟、高吞吐、容错性强的特点,使其成为众多企业和组织实时数据处理首选的技术平台。以下是实时计算Flink版的一些典型使用合集。
17 0
http://www.vxiaotou.com